Portfolio Manager - Private Asset Management
This role serves as a central point of contact for high net worth clients and is responsible for overseeing investment portfolios and delivering personalized advice.
Responsibilities
- Builds successful investment portfolios informed by market conditions and economic trends.
- Maintains accurate records and documentation for audits and client reporting.
- Recommends portfolio adjustments to grow client’s net worth based on industry trends identified through market and risk analysis.
- Executes securities transactions in client portfolios to maintain a specific investment strategy or to reach an investment objective.
- Determines acceptable risk levels with clients based on time frames, risk preferences, return expectations, and market conditions.
- Evaluates the performance of investment portfolios and ensures compliance with standards provided by regulatory organizations including conformance with investor disclosures, privacy laws, anti-money laundering requirements, and anti-fraud measures.
- Maintains new and existing client relationships, including informing clients of market conditions, updating them on investment research and economic trends, and meeting with them to discuss their portfolio performance and investment objectives.
- Maintains and informs team of updated knowledge of capital markets and the investment management industry to make informed decisions and implement best practices.
- Provides input into investment models and allocation frameworks.
- Supports business development and client retention initiatives.
- All licenses must be obtained within 120 days from start date.
